Correct, but..
I think they'll have to be evolved developments of the network "black boxes" like the entertainment/media servers and NAS's that companies like Netgear and Linksys are starting to make.

The joke used to be that most peoples VCRs had the time flashing because they didn't know how to set them, now most modern VCRs set it automatically, and we have online program guides for setting program record times for some DVR's.

A home server will have to be this simple to capture the mass market, and I think the consumer device companies like Sony and Toshiba have more of a track record in this area than MS.

Mind you if a future Windows Home Media server goes mass market without that kind of simplicity anyone in our business will make a fortune from support.
